A traffic collision occurred today at the intersection of Arnold Road and Quick Road in Winterhaven, CA, involving a single vehicle that entered a canal. The incident was reported at approximately 3:39 PM, prompting an immediate response from emergency services to manage the situation.
The vehicle, which is not drivable, was reported to have two adults inside. As a result of the collision, a flooded area near a railroad bridge developed, with water levels reaching approximately three feet. This flooding significantly impacted traffic flow, leading to necessary road adjustments and access instructions for motorists.
Authorities advised drivers to utilize alternate routes, specifically Yuma Road, to avoid delays and congestion in the area. Multiple emergency service units were deployed to control the scene and direct traffic, ensuring safety for all road users.
